head	1.5;
access;
symbols
	RELEASE_8_3_0:1.4
	RELEASE_9_0_0:1.3
	RELEASE_7_4_0:1.2
	RELEASE_8_2_0:1.2
	RELEASE_6_EOL:1.2
	RELEASE_8_1_0:1.2
	RELEASE_7_3_0:1.2
	RELEASE_8_0_0:1.2
	RELEASE_7_2_0:1.2
	RELEASE_7_1_0:1.2
	RELEASE_6_4_0:1.2
	RELEASE_5_EOL:1.2
	RELEASE_7_0_0:1.2
	RELEASE_6_3_0:1.2
	PRE_XORG_7:1.2
	RELEASE_4_EOL:1.2
	RELEASE_6_2_0:1.2
	RELEASE_6_1_0:1.1
	RELEASE_5_5_0:1.1;
locks; strict;
comment	@# @;


1.5
date	2012.11.17.05.54.20;	author svnexp;	state Exp;
branches;
next	1.4;

1.4
date	2012.02.12.09.09.18;	author danfe;	state Exp;
branches;
next	1.3;

1.3
date	2011.09.01.03.27.26;	author danfe;	state Exp;
branches;
next	1.2;

1.2
date	2006.05.03.05.14.01;	author edwin;	state Exp;
branches;
next	1.1;

1.1
date	2005.12.20.15.55.30;	author danfe;	state Exp;
branches;
next	;


desc
@@


1.5
log
@Switch exporter over
@
text
@# New ports collection makefile for:	DeuTex
# Date created:				20 Dec 2005
# Whom:					Alexey Dokuchaev <danfe@@FreeBSD.org>
#
# $FreeBSD: head/archivers/deutex/Makefile 300895 2012-07-14 12:56:14Z beat $
#

PORTNAME=	deutex
PORTVERSION=	4.4.0
PORTREVISION=	1
CATEGORIES=	archivers games
MASTER_SITES=	http://www.teaser.fr/~amajorel/deutex/ \
		http://freebsd.nsu.ru/distfiles/

MAINTAINER=	danfe@@FreeBSD.org
COMMENT=	WAD file manipulator for Doom, Heretic, Hexen, and Strife

LICENSE=	GPLv2

MAKE_ARGS=	CC="${CC}" CFLAGS="${CFLAGS}"

MAN6=		${PORTNAME}.6
PLIST_FILES=	bin/deusf bin/deutex
PORTDOCS=	*

post-extract:
	@@${REINPLACE_CMD} -e 's,-mkdir,mkdir -p,' ${WRKSRC}/Makefile
	@@${REINPLACE_CMD} -e 's,malloc\.h,stdlib.h,' ${WRKSRC}/src/tools.c
	@@${REINPLACE_CMD} -e '/blockv/s,VOCHEAD,VOCBLOCK1,' \
		${WRKSRC}/src/sound.c

do-install:
	${INSTALL_PROGRAM} ${WRKSRC}/deusf ${WRKSRC}/deutex ${PREFIX}/bin
	${INSTALL_MAN} ${WRKSRC}/${MAN6} ${MANPREFIX}/man/man6
.if !defined(NOPORTDOCS)
	@@${MKDIR} ${DOCSDIR}
	${INSTALL_DATA} ${WRKSRC}/CHANGES ${WRKSRC}/TODO ${DOCSDIR}
	${INSTALL_DATA} ${WRKSRC}/dtexman6.txt ${DOCSDIR}/MANUAL
.endif

.include <bsd.port.mk>
@


1.4
log
@- Fix bad work with data types between architectures which resulted in
  immediate segfault when being run on e.g. amd64
- Fix wrong length when reading block into structure (probably a typo)
- Other minor non-functional fixes

PR:		ports/161664
Submitted by:	Cray Elliott
@
text
@d5 1
a5 1
# $FreeBSD$
@


1.3
log
@- Adjust COMMENT
- Add LICENSE (GPLv2)
- Install changelog
- Do some minor cleanups
@
text
@d10 1
d27 1
d29 2
@


1.2
log
@Remove USE_REINPLACE from ports in categories starting with A.
@
text
@d15 3
a17 1
COMMENT=	WAD file composer for Doom, Heretic, Hexen, and Strife
d21 1
d23 1
a23 3
PORTDOCS=	MANUAL TODO

MAN6=		${PORTNAME}.6
d26 1
a26 1
	@@${REINPLACE_CMD} -e 's,malloc\.h,stdlib\.h,' ${WRKSRC}/src/tools.c
d33 1
a33 1
	${INSTALL_DATA} ${WRKSRC}/TODO ${DOCSDIR}
@


1.1
log
@Add deutex 4.4.0, an advanced WAD composer for games like Doom, Heretic,
Hexen, and Strife.

WWW: http://www.teaser.fr/~amajorel/deutex/
@
text
@a16 2
USE_REINPLACE=	yes

@

